From 1990s, professional tournament with representatives of professional football, basketball, table tennis has been shown in our country. The continued and orderly professional events has made great contribution to enhance the competitive level of sports, to meet the spiritual needs and to increase employment of sports industry as well as promote the development of leisure sports industry. But it also exposed some problems.In academic field, most of the international studies stand from the perspective of micro-economic and with a greater difference between the actual situations in China. And domestic researches always focus on a certain event that can not give an overall integrity of professional tournaments.In this paper, the whole concept of professional events were defined and summarized. We limit the study target to the sports industry which have been introduced in or have the potential to become professional tournament. Through analysis of the value chain, we creatively introduce the industry chain theory and formate a division of professional tournament industry as upstream industry including tournament owner or whole purveyor of the sport events, middle reaches including Destination Management Companies, and downstream industries including sports media and athlete training institutions.Comparing with more mature professional events such as the NBA matches from the United States, and England Premiership, there are a lot of problems in China's professional tournament. In the upper reaches of the industry, the owner of our professional tournament is trade association with Governmental background, resulting property rights'lack of clarity. In the middle reaches of the industry, destination management companies as contractors are missing. Instead, professional clubs are playing this role resulting in a non-professional work. The downstream industries of professional tournament in China are in confused management. Intermediaries'missing leads to a chaotic copyright market and athletes training industry suffered from lack of incentive mechanisms and a seriously limit transfer regulation. In addition, the assessment function is missing because of the coincidence of supervisor and organizer. From the view of the whole industry, the current industry value chain model leads to a poor delievery from the consumer to the element supply side. To solve these problems, some industrial chain solutions are putting forward in these articles which are divided into four areas. The first one is to clear property rights and goal of professional events. The second one is to introduce the middle reaches of DMC. The third one is to support the key link of the downstream industry. And the fourth one is to build a sound supervisory system.
